  7. GROTESQUE FIGURE

    THIS IS NOT A HOLD-UP MAN!--It is a masked and goggled winchman on one of the four overseas freighters loading 29,700 tens of Victorian wheat at Williamstown today. The mask and goggles are worn to protect his mouth, nose and eyes from the dust rising from the wheat, which is emptied into ... [ILLUSTRATED]
